Plot Summary
The film depicts the tragic journey of a group of young Greek conscripts during the Turkish invasion of Cyprus in 1974. Their mission to reach a strategic location becomes a desperate fight for survival as they face the harsh realities of war and betrayal. Amidst the chaos and violence, their bonds are tested and their innocence is shattered.
